Understanding the Significance of Payroll Data Export

Exporting payroll data from QuickBooks Online plays a crucial role in managing your company’s financial health and compliance. Here’s why it matters:

1. Compliance and Reporting:

Exported payroll data serves as a valuable resource during tax season and regulatory audits. It provides a detailed history of employee compensation, tax withholdings, and other payroll-related information, ensuring compliance with legal requirements.

2. Financial Analysis and Insights:

Exported data can be a treasure trove of information for financial analysis. It enables businesses to gain insights into labor costs, trends in compensation, and overall payroll expenditures. This data can inform decisions related to budgeting, forecasting, and optimizing the workforce.

3. Data Redundancy and Backup:

Maintaining a secure, local copy of your payroll data acts as an insurance policy against data loss or system failures. It ensures that essential information is readily accessible, reducing downtime and potential financial losses.

Step-by-Step Guide to Streamlining Payroll Data Management

Follow these steps to efficiently export payroll data from QuickBooks Online:

1. Log into Your QuickBooks Online Account:

Start by accessing your QuickBooks Online account with your credentials.

2. Navigate to the Payroll Center:

In the left navigation bar, click on “Workers” or “Employees” (depending on your QuickBooks Online version) to access the Payroll Center.

3. Select the Reports Tab:

Within the Payroll Center, locate and click on the “Reports” tab. Here, you’ll find a selection of payroll-related reports that can be customized and exported.

4. Choose a Relevant Payroll Report:

Select the specific payroll report that aligns with the data you want to export. Popular options include the Payroll Summary, Payroll Detail, and Payroll Liabilities reports.

5. Customize the Report Settings:

Leverage the customization options provided to filter the data by time period, employees, and other relevant criteria. Ensure that the report contains the information you need.

6. Generate the Report:

Click the “Run Report” or “View Report” button to generate the customized report. Take a moment to review the data for accuracy.

7. Initiate the Export:

Within the report, locate and click on the “Export” button. QuickBooks Online typically offers export formats such as Excel (XLSX) or CSV (Comma-Separated Values).

8. Save the Exported File:

Choose a designated location on your computer to save the exported file. Creating a dedicated folder for payroll exports can help keep your data organized.

9. Verify the Exported Data:

Before proceeding further, open the exported file to verify that the data is complete and accurate. Double-check key details, including employee names, wages, and tax deductions.

10. Establish a Data Backup Routine:

Implement a regular data backup routine for your exported payroll data. Store backups securely, either in the cloud or on external storage devices, to ensure data integrity.

Best Practices for Streamlining Payroll Data Management

To enhance your payroll data management processes, consider the following best practices:

1. Regular Data Backups:

Perform regular data backups within QuickBooks Online to maintain an up-to-date repository of your payroll information, reducing the risk of data loss.

2. Compliance Awareness:

Stay informed about tax regulations, labor laws, and payroll compliance standards relevant to your business. Compliance is essential for accuracy when exporting payroll data.

3. Data Validation:

Before exporting payroll data, conduct a thorough validation process to identify and rectify any discrepancies or errors within QuickBooks Online.

4. Secure Data Storage:

Practice secure data storage for both exported and backup files. Implement encryption, password protection, and access controls to safeguard sensitive payroll information.
